Fan how hard should it blow?

I was running my air conditioning today in my 71 Super and it just doesn't seem to blow very hard. Its a stock unit and the air is very cold. If you put the fan switch on high ( all the way down ) it won't blow at all. I run the air more just to run it than I do
because of heat ( Ontario,NY doesn't get that hot ) Just wondering if this normal or is the fan switch bad? I know it is'nt going to freeze me out of the truck but I would like it to blow alittle harder.
